Simulation of the radiative spectra for Ar-H2O-Hg mixtures in high pressure lamps: influence of the presence of H2O
Résumé
This work is focused on the influence of water radiation in Ar-H2O-Hg mixtures used in high pressure lamps. The paper is divided into several parts describing how the radiations issued from atomic continuum and lines, molecular continuum and lines are obtained. Some radiative spectra are presented as a result in order to highlight the influence of water in the plasma, in the UV, visible and IR spectral ranges.
